  • Abstract
    In this study, the performances of the micropump with active type diaphragm actuated by thermoelectric and piezoelectric have been compared. Finite element analysis (FEA) by ANSYS®8.1 had used to simulate and analyze the deflection of the diaphragm. The FEA model actuated by thermoelectric and piezoelectric is validated by the available data. The success of the model in predicting the displacement of the diaphragm provides further encouragement in using the model to compare the diaphragm deflection actuated by difference actuated method but with same diaphragm size and actuated power. The optimized design by using thermoelectric actuator has then been shown.
